Output f3ab44a89a07661bd98ddd9d77e23c318c39714a259656e551c81a0076ef7543:3

value
355488143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f282879926949d1f0d7a0c7010cfa1a0e18b6e1 OP_EQUAL
address
37Sxbs1ocRPCNUS7zn8kQLp35EV3AuKn4e
transaction
f3ab44a89a07661bd98ddd9d77e23c318c39714a259656e551c81a0076ef7543
spent
true